Method and system for diagnosing radio performance during functional over-the-air operation

1. An apparatus for determining a health of a mobile radio-frequency transmitter, the apparatus comprising:

  • a receiver for receiving a received signal responsive to a transmitted signal transmitted from the mobile transmitter, the transmitted signal transmitted during normal over-the-air operation of the mobile transmitter and not having known signal characteristics;

    a first element for determining a first signal parameters value of the received signal, the first signal parameter value responsive to signal power of the received signal;

    the first element for determining additional signal parameter values of the received signal;

    the transmitted signal and the received signal each including an identifier of the mobile transmitter, the identifier for linking the first signal parameter value and the additional signal parameter values with the mobile transmitter; and

    a second element for determining whether the first signal parameter value exceeds a predetermined value;

    if the first signal parameter value exceeds the predetermined value, the second element for determining a health of the mobile transmitter, the health responsive to a relationship between one or more of the additional signal parameter values and a respective specification value or a range of respective specification values for each one of the additional signal parameter values, wherein the respective specification value or the range of respective specification values are independent of distance and link quality between the mobile transmitter and the receiver.
